Naturally available SA was used to prepare blend
membranes by adding different amount of Soya protein
(10, 30, 40 and 50 wt %). Membranes were crosslinked
with a glutaraldehyde / Hydrochloric acid mixture, which
acted as a unique compound to impart good strength and
membrane performance to water in terms of flux and
selectivity. Blend compatibility was confirmed by DSC,
whereas membrane crosslinking was confirmed by FTIR.
Pervaporation dehydration of the membranes was tested for
water + isopropanol mixture at 300C. The blend membranes
of SA/SPI containing 50 wt % SPI showed higher
permeation flux for the water + isopropanol, whereas
higher selectivity up to 891 was observed for the blend
membrane containing similar wt % ratio from the aqueous
streams.
